imageSmall businesses in Bourton-on-the-Water achieve significant growth by implementing targeted local search engine optimisation strategies.

Business owners must prioritise UK-specific keywords that align perfectly with local search trends. For example, a local bakery or cafe captures a highly targeted audience by using location-based phrases like "best coffee in Bourton-on-the-Water."

This precise keyword integration directly connects companies with residents and tourists who actively seek specific local services.

By optimising their online presence for these specific terms, local enterprises foster deep community engagement and build lasting brand loyalty.

imageA robust website foundation requires excellent on-page optimisation that specifically targets the local audience.

Web developers and content creators must naturally weave local keywords into headers, compelling meta tags, and image alt texts.

Furthermore, responsive design plays a critical role for companies that operate in the Bourton-on-the-Water market.

Website administrators must ensure rapid loading speeds and intuitive navigation across all mobile devices to satisfy users.

These technical improvements dramatically enhance the overall user experience and encourage visitors to explore the site further.

Consequently, search engines reward these user-friendly websites with much higher rankings in local search results.

Beyond the website itself, proactive off-page strategies solidify a company's reputation within the Gloucestershire region.

Local business owners build crucial authority by acquiring high-quality backlinks from UK-based directories and regional websites.

Entrepreneurs often form strategic partnerships with other Bourton-on-the-Water organisations to co-host events or launch joint promotional campaigns.

These collaborative efforts generate valuable local citations and increase community visibility simultaneously.

Participating in local sponsorships also allows companies to share insightful content and establish themselves as trusted neighbourhood authorities.

Ultimately, these ethical link-building practices drive consistent foot traffic and ensure sustainable online success.

Continuous monitoring allows Bourton-on-the-Water merchants to refine their digital marketing campaigns effectively.

Marketers utilise robust tools such as Google Analytics and Search Console to track website traffic patterns and monitor keyword rankings closely.

By analysing this visitor data, managers identify successful tactics and quickly pivot away from underperforming strategies.

As the business expands its reach across the UK, leaders scale their efforts by introducing broader search terms while maintaining their core local focus.

This proactive approach guarantees long-term growth and helps local shops maintain a formidable competitive edge in an evolving digital marketplace.
